探索Redis实现高效并发请求(并发请求redis)

的方法 随着互联网行业高速发展,用户对高效并发请求的要求也越来越高。满足高效并发请求是互联网开发者面临的一大难题,我着重…

的方法

随着互联网行业高速发展,用户对高效并发请求的要求也越来越高。满足高效并发请求是互联网开发者面临的一大难题,我着重来介绍如何利用Redis实现高效并发请求。

Redis是一种基于内存高速访问的数据库,它可以很好地解决读写高效并发。单台服务器支持高达千万级别的并发请求,而传统的关系型数据库无法做到。此外,Redis还提供了良好的集群支持,能够将数据存储在多台服务器上,实现大容量存储和高throughput的更新操作。

Redis也可以提供它的“Pub/Sub”功能,这种功能可以用来实现高效并行请求。在“Pub/Sub”模式下,服务器只需要将消息发布,而不需要显式建立额外连接,从而避免了资源分配和维护等问题。

Redis还提供了强大的集合、字符串和散列等数据结构,可以用来有效的提高并发性能,减少资源消耗。

以上就是如何利用Redis实现高效并发请求的方法。下面我将用一段示例代码说明如何使用Redis进行并发请求:

// 定义Redis实例

var redisClient = require(‘redis’).createClient();

// 使用Redis消息队列实现并发请求

redisClient.on(‘message’, function (channel, message) {

// 处理并发请求

});

// 订阅消息队列

redisClient.subscribe(‘my_channel’);

// 发布消息

redisClient.publish(‘my_channel’, ‘hello world!’);

以上就是如何利用Redis实现高效并发请求的方法。Redis不仅能够提供快速的数据存储和更新,还能够提供可靠的消息队列机制,从而有效支持高效并发请求。作为一名互联网开发者,学习和掌握Redis的运用,可以极大的提高网站的性能。

香港服务器首选港服(Server.HK),2H2G首月10元开通。
港服(Server.HK)(www.IDC.Net)提供简单好用,价格厚道的香港/美国云服务器和独立服务器。IDC+ISP+ICP资质。ARIN和APNIC会员。成熟技术团队15年行业经验。

为您推荐

港服(Server.HK)MongoDB教程:MongoDB 索引

MongoDB 索引 索引通常能够极大的提高查询的效率,如果没有索引,MongoDB在读取数据时必须扫描集合中的每个文件...

港服(Server.HK)PostgreSQL教程PostgreSQL 别名

PostgreSQL 别名 我们可以用 SQL 重命名一张表或者一个字段的名称,这个名称就叫着该表或该字段的别名。 创建...

港服(Server.HK)Memcached教程:Memcached stats 命令

Memcached stats 命令 Memcached stats 命令用于返回统计信息例如 PID(进程号)、版本号...

港服(Server.HK)Redis教程:Redis 数据类型

Redis 数据类型 Redis支持五种数据类型:string(字符串),hash(哈希),list(列表),set(集...

港服(Server.HK)Redis教程:Redis GEO

Redis GEO Redis GEO 主要用于存储地理位置信息,并对存储的信息进行操作,该功能在 Redis 3.2 ...
返回顶部